BlueSoleil allows MS Windows users to wirelessly access a wide variety of Bluetooth enabled digital devices, such as cameras, mobile phones, headsets, printers, and GPS receivers. You can also form networks and exchange data with other Bluetooth enabled computers or PDAs. Platforms supported by BlueSoleil include: Windows 98SE, ME, 2000, and XP. 1.1 Bluetooth Functions In order to connect and share services via Bluetooth wireless technology, two devices must support the same Bluetooth Profile(s) as well as opposite device roles (i.e., one must be the server, and the other must be the client). Bluetooth enabled devices often support multiple profiles, and if involved in multiple connections, can perform different device roles simultaneously. By default, BlueSoleil starts with the Main Window open. Use the Main Window to perform your primary connection operations. The Main Window displays the local device (red ball) as well as the remote devices detected in range. Different icons distinguish different types of remote devices. At the top of the Main Window are Service Buttons. After you search for the services supported by a remote device, the supported services of the selected device will be highlighted.
